OverviewInsight Global is seeking a Satellite Engineer III to support a large-scale satellite deployment initiative for a leading telecommunications client. This role will focus on the design, planning, and delivery of GEO, LEO, and hybrid satellite transport solutions, including Starlink systems. The engineer will play a critical role in configuring satellite links, planning antenna installations, supporting field deployments, and leading complex engineering efforts.
